Which one of the following could be the frequency of ultraviolet radiation?

Correct answer: D. 1.0 x 10^15Hz

  • A. 1.0 x 10^6Hz
  • B. 1.0 x 10^9Hz
  • C. 1.0 x 10^12Hz
  • D. 1.0 x 10^15Hz

Explanation

The frequency of ultraviolet radiation can indeed be around 1.0 x 10^15 Hz. Ultraviolet (UV) radiation has a higher frequency than visible light, which is why we can't see it with our eyes. It falls in the electromagnetic spectrum between visible light and X-rays. UV radiation has various applications, such as in sterilization, tanning, and even in some medical treatments.

About Waves

Progressive waves transfer energy through oscillations, with wavelength, frequency, amplitude and wave speed related by v = fλ; sound speed depends on the medium. Superposition produces interference and stationary waves in strings and organ pipes, while simple harmonic motion describes the oscillation itself and must be distinguished from wave propagation.
